Transaction 1077750f8475935c2100ce41358ce3991766cfd87fa40265034f02adfc5eff69

1 Input
2 Outputs
  • 1077750f8475935c2100ce41358ce3991766cfd87fa40265034f02adfc5eff69:0
  • value  2740198
    address  1HgA9NewkaHuR688vht3J43iyiSA2ETLdC
  • 1077750f8475935c2100ce41358ce3991766cfd87fa40265034f02adfc5eff69:1
  • value  84750022
    address  1AY4zxWnWruQfrVE31H9YdbyUy1WueCPLJ